Inova Fairfax Hospital Among Nation’s Top 5% for Clinical Quality

National Honor Finds Consistent Hospital-Wide Clinical Excellence

Falls Church, VA – (January 27, 2009) – Inova Fairfax Hospital has been named a recipient of the 2009 Distinguished Hospital for Clinical Excellence Award by HealthGrades, an independent healthcare ratings organization. The award, based on an analysis of more than 41 million Medicare hospital discharges from 2005 to 2007, is given to only the top 5 percent of hospitals in the nation and rates 26 procedures and diagnoses from heart attacks to total knee replacement.

Of the nation’s 5,000 acute-care hospitals, only 270 hospitals are designated as HealthGrades’s Distinguished Hospitals for Clinical Excellence™. In HealthGrades’ Seventh Annual Hospital Quality and Clinical Excellence analysis, these 270 distinguished hospitals are compared to all other U.S. hospitals to identify trends in outcomes, relative risk and improvement for the years 2005, 2006 and 2007.

From 2005 to 2007, Distinguished Hospitals showed greater improvement with an average:

  • Reduction in risk-adjusted mortality of 18 percent, compared to 13 percent for all other hospitals
  • Reduction in risk-adjusted in-hospital complications of 4 percent, compared to 2.5 percent for all other hospitals.

HealthGrades also finds that if all hospitals performed at the level of Distinguished Hospitals, more than 152,000 deaths may have been prevented and more than 11,700 in-hospital complications may have been avoided. In addition, Medicare patients had, on average, an 8 percent lower risk of in-hospital complications at a Distinguished Hospital for Clinical Excellence for diagnoses and procedures that include orthopedic and neurosurgery, vascular surgery, prostate surgery and gall bladder surgery.

“Distinguished Hospitals for Clinical Excellence comprise a group of hospitals that excel across the board, not just in one or two specialties,” said Rick May, MD, HealthGrades senior physician consultant and an author of the study. “[These hospitals] should be commended for their relentless commitment to exceptional patient care.”
